CakePHP vs Zend Framework : Which is Better?

CakePHP icon

CakePHP

CakePHP is an open-source web framework. It follows the model–view–controller (MVC) approach and is written in PHP, modeled after the concepts of Ruby on Rails, and distributed under the MIT License.

License: Open Source

Apps available for Mac OS X Windows Linux Online Self-Hosted

VS
VS
Zend Framework icon

Zend Framework

Zend Framework (ZF) is an open source, object-oriented web application framework implemented in PHP 5 and licensed under the New BSD License. Developed by Zend

License: Open Source

Categories: Development

Apps available for Mac OS X Windows Linux Online

CakePHP VS Zend Framework

CakePHP is known for its simplicity and rapid development capabilities, making it ideal for small to medium-sized applications. In contrast, Zend Framework offers a robust and modular architecture that is better suited for large-scale, enterprise-level applications.

CakePHP

Pros:

  • Easy to learn and use
  • Rapid application development
  • Built-in features for security
  • Strong community support
  • Flexible ORM (Object-Relational Mapping)

Cons:

  • Less performance compared to some frameworks
  • Limited built-in tools for complex apps
  • Can be less flexible for large-scale projects

Zend Framework

Pros:

  • Highly modular architecture
  • Extensive documentation
  • Enterprise-ready features
  • Strong performance and scalability
  • Customizable components

Cons:

  • Steep learning curve for beginners
  • More complex setup and configuration
  • Can be overkill for small projects

Compare CakePHP

vs
Compare Agile Toolkit and CakePHP and decide which is most suitable for you.
vs
Compare Awes.io and CakePHP and decide which is most suitable for you.
vs
Compare CodeIgniter and CakePHP and decide which is most suitable for you.
vs
Compare FuelPHP and CakePHP and decide which is most suitable for you.
vs
Compare ImpressPages CMS and CakePHP and decide which is most suitable for you.
vs
Compare Laravel and CakePHP and decide which is most suitable for you.
vs
Compare PHP Fat-Free Framework and CakePHP and decide which is most suitable for you.
vs
Compare Pimcore and CakePHP and decide which is most suitable for you.
vs
Compare Ruby on Rails and CakePHP and decide which is most suitable for you.
vs
Compare Symfony and CakePHP and decide which is most suitable for you.
vs
Compare Yii Framework and CakePHP and decide which is most suitable for you.